As part of HVAC Heating, Patterson Kelley is a leading manufacturer of commercial boilers and direct and indirect water heaters. With an over 140 year history, we provide reliable, innovative comfort solutions for hospitals, schools, military bases, and stadiums.

As the Field Services Supervisor, you manage the field service/technical customer service team and coordinate theTechnical Service and Training/Certification activities of Boiler and Water Heater Product lines. The Field Service Supervisors also so applies knowledge for installation, service, preventative maintenance, and repair items that are sold, leased, or rented with service contract, warranty, and/or general maintenance.

SPX is a diversified, global supplier of infrastructure equipment with scalable growth platforms in heating, ventilation and air conditioning (HVAC), detection and measurement, and engineered solutions. With operations in 17 countries and approximately $1.4 billion in annual revenue, we offer a wide array of highly engineered products with strong brands.
